Output 0465c2b392403d689f60f287c981ab5e16d152bfff4068a508543385ed1227f4:1

value
1304363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46019b86a7f8cf95f38927ab5e8738d030dd0bc7 OP_EQUALVERIFY OP_CHECKSIG
address
17PAE81RfWzpfaP7bmpKEsYMQSNwynecK2
transaction
0465c2b392403d689f60f287c981ab5e16d152bfff4068a508543385ed1227f4
confirmations
318723
spent
true